Output 24e301c29d74fa29cccddc44c1c8406b13e608f2c03617045146decde54d8d7f:0

value
2834350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bb9e8b959aa768c9fd080872ae935a153719d9 OP_EQUAL
address
3FtTRJ8bVp8GSwqDWuRemfWuG3gh2DTWx8
transaction
24e301c29d74fa29cccddc44c1c8406b13e608f2c03617045146decde54d8d7f
spent
true